Where to stay in Redmond

Find the best Redmond areas and neighborhoods for the activities you enjoy most.

Union Hill-Novelty Hill

This family-friendly suburban retreat sits just outside Redmond's urban core. Union Hill-Novelty Hill offers peaceful residential living amid evergreen forests and natural preserves. Spacious homes on generous lots create an upscale atmosphere where visitors experience authentic American suburban life. The neighborhood connects to nearby Redmond Town Center for shopping and dining options. Outdoor enthusiasts can explore hiking trails through the Redmond Watershed Preserve's old-growth forest. With limited public transit, a rental car provides the best access to this quiet, nature-filled community.

Overlake

Home to Microsoft's main campus and Nintendo of America headquarters, this area boasts a bustling retail district along 148th Avenue N.E. and N.E. 24th Street, with easy access to Seattle via State Route 520.

Education Hill

Education Hill balances suburban calm with outdoor recreation in Redmond's family-friendly residential area. Tree-lined streets lead to welcoming parks like Hartman and Nike, where walking trails and playgrounds invite relaxation. The neighborhood's well-maintained homes create a peaceful atmosphere away from city bustle. A short drive takes you to Redmond Performing Arts Center and nearby shopping at Redmond Town Center. Though quiet within its boundaries, Education Hill provides easy access to dining and entertainment options just minutes away. DigiPen Institute of Technology adds a modern tech vibe to this green retreat.

Downtown Redmond

Downtown Redmond balances business energy with pedestrian-friendly charm. Microsoft's headquarters anchors this tech hub while Redmond Town Center offers open-air shopping and dining. Cleveland Street features welcoming outdoor plazas perfect for people-watching. Green spaces like Downtown Park provide peaceful retreats between meetings. Visitors appreciate the area's walkable design with wide sidewalks and landscaped medians. The dining scene reflects the international tech workforce with upscale casual options. Nearby Marymoor Park and the Sammamish River Trail offer additional outdoor recreation for nature lovers.

Best time to go to Redmond

The best time to visit Redmond can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Redmond falls in August, when visitor numbers are average and weather is sunny with no rain. The coolest average temperature in Redmond falls in December,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January39.7°F (4.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February39.6°F (4.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March43.0°F (6.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April47.5°F (8.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
May54.7°F (12.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June59.9°F (15.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
July66.0°F (18.9°C)No R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
August66.4°F (19.1°C)No RainSunnyAverageSlightly High
September60.6°F (15.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
October52.0°F (11.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
November43.7°F (6.5°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
December38.5°F (3.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low

How should I get around Redmond?
You can access metro transit at Downtown Redmond Station, Marymoor Village Station, and Redmond Technology Station. If you want to venture out around the area, you may want a rental car in Redmond for your journey.
What's the weather like in Redmond?
The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 63°F, while the coldest months are February and December with an average of 40°F. The rainiest months in Redmond are November, January, December, and October, with each month seeing an average of 7 inches of rainfall.
